8k-1=15 ? Help I have a question were we have to work this out what do I do?

you have to add 1 to the -1 and you will get 0.What you have to do next is also add 1 to 15 because you want a variable on one side and a number on the other.So now you have 8k=16. So you divide 8 to 8k and you get nothing divide 8 and 16 and your answer for k =2 hope you get it right.trust mw it is very easy when you get use to it
